/* Post Voting */
.xt-votes {
  margin-top: 40px;
  margin-bottom: 40px;
  clear: both;
}
@media (min-width: 0) and (max-width: 479px) {

	.xt-votes {
	  	text-align: center!important;
	}
	.xt-likes, .xt-dislikes {
	    text-align: center!important;
	}

}    

.xt-likes, .xt-dislikes {
  padding: 12px 15px;
  text-align: center;
  display: inline-block;
  line-height: 1em;
}
.xt-likes .fa, .xt-dislikes .fa{
  margin-right:5px;
  font-size:16px
}
body.rtl .xt-likes .fa, .xt-dislikes .fa {
	margin-left:5px;
	margin-right:inherit;
}

.xt-votes .xt-likes {
  	margin: 0 10px 0 0;
  	color: #59AA19;
}
body.rtl .xt-votes .xt-likes {
	margin: 0 0 0 10px;
}

.xt-votes .xt-dislikes {
  margin: 0;
  color: #c84848;
}
.xt-likes i, .xt-dislikes span {
  font-size: 14px;
  margin: 0 3px 0 0;
}
.xt-votes .xt-like_btn {
  color: #59AA19;
}
.xt-votes .xt-dislike_btn {
  color: #c84848;
}
.xt-like_btn, .xt-dislike_btn {
  text-decoration: none;
  display: inline-block;
}
.xt-votes .xt-like_btn:hover {
  color: #59AA19;
}
.xt-votes .xt-dislike_btn:hover {
  color: #c84848;
}
.xt-like_btn:hover, .xt-dislike_btn:hover {
  text-decoration: none;
  opacity: 0.85;
}

@media (max-width: 479px) {
	.xt-likes, .xt-dislikes {
	    display: block;
	}
	.xt-votes .xt-likes{
	    margin:0 0 10px;
	}
}




